Harrogate to host free high-energy fitness event

The ANYROCKS fitness challenge is coming to Harrogate in September.

Fitness enthusiasts across Harrogate are invited to take part in a new challenge event this September, with options for all abilities and fitness levels.

The ANYROCKS Challenge will take place on Saturday 6th September at the Harrogate Leisure and Wellbeing Hub, open exclusively to members of Active North Yorkshire leisure centres. 

The event is free to enter, and participants can choose between competitive or relaxed formats.

Running from 7am to 1pm, the challenge features a series of fitness stations including running, rowing, ski erg, squat presses, and other high-energy activities. 

Participants can enter either the singles or doubles categories. In the doubles category, members are allowed to bring a non-member guest for free, making it a social as well as physical event.

Organisers say the event is designed to appeal to a wide range of abilities. 

The competitive sessions will be timed, while the relaxed sessions allow for participants to modify, skip or pace the challenges to suit their comfort level.

Timetable:

  • 7am–8:30am – Competitive Singles
  • 8:30am–10am – Competitive Doubles
  • 10am–11:30am – Relaxed Singles
  • 11:30am–1pm – Relaxed Doubles

The full exercise lineup includes:

  • 1 kilometre run (repeated multiple times)
  • 100m ski erg
  • 50 squat presses
  • 100m row
  • 200m farmer’s carry
  • 100m sandbag lunges
  • 100m wall balls

Booking is essential. Active North Yorkshire members can sign up by emailing the organisers with their name and category choice. Only one booking is needed for doubles teams.
